Each product must meet specified dimensions to ensure compatibility with installation systems, which can significantly affect the overall performance and aesthetics of outdoor spaces. During the quality inspection process, precise measurements are taken, using calibrated tools to confirm that each board adheres to the predefined length, width, and thickness tolerances. Any deviations can lead to complications during installation, resulting in potential structural weaknesses or misaligned surfaces that detract from the visual appeal of the decking.<\/p>\n<p>To execute this dimensional accuracy testing effectively, inspectors measure multiple samples from different batches, ensuring that a consistent standard is maintained throughout production. A thorough evaluation of density involves measuring the mass of a specific volume of the material, which directly correlates to performance characteristics such as strength, weight, and resistance to environmental factors. Higher density generally suggests a more robust product, capable of withstanding the rigours of outdoor applications.<\/p>\n<p>Quality inspection supervisors carry out density tests by using standardised methods, ensuring that results are consistent across different samples. Products that do not meet the required density thresholds may be susceptible to warping, moisture absorption, or even breakage under load. Therefore, maintaining optimal density levels becomes a quality control priority, especially in climates subject to diverse weather patterns.<\/p>\n<p><img decoding=\"async\" src=\"https:\/\/woodedtech.com\/wp-content\/uploads\/2026\/09\/\u77f3\u5934.jpg\" alt=\"\" style=\"max-width:100%;height:auto;\" \/><\/p>\n<h2>Evaluating Impact Resistance<\/h2>\n<p>Impact resistance is another critical test that differentiates composite decking from PVC decking. This performance metric assesses how well a material can withstand sudden forces without deforming or breaking. It is particularly important in outdoor environments where impacts from falling objects or heavy foot traffic may occur. The testing typically involves dropping a weighted object from a predetermined height onto the decking material and measuring the resultant damage.<\/p>\n<pQuality inspectors systematically conduct these impact tests to determine the resilience of WPC products. This property can critically affect the longevity and integrity of both composite and PVC decking. During inspection, samples are submerged in water for a specific duration, post which their weight is measured to determine the amount of moisture absorbed.<\/p>\n<p>Low water absorption rates indicate superior durability, reducing the likelihood of mould growth, swelling, or degradation in performance over time. WPC materials often outperform traditional wood in this regard, and rigorous testing allows inspectors to provide customers with proof of the product&#8217;s capabilities in resisting moisture damage. These results are crucial for informing consumers about the best choices for their specific environmental conditions.<\/p>\n<h2>Assessing Colour Stability<\/h2>\n<p>Colour stability is a significant aesthetic consideration in the outdoor decking market. As materials are exposed to sunlight, the potential for fading can profoundly impact their visual appeal. WPC products undergo accelerated weathering tests to evaluate how well they retain their colour over time. These tests simulate conditions of UV exposure, helping to predict how the decking will perform in real-world applications.<\/p>\n<p>During the inspection process, colour samples are compared before and after exposure to identify any significant changes. The ability to maintain original hues serves not only to enhance customer satisfaction but also to reduce the frequency of replacement, benefiting both the consumer and the environment.
